Xoxoday Loyalife applies Slowly Changing Dimension (SCD) modelling to loyalty program data, preserving historical records of member attributes, tier changes, and point transactions to meet compliance and audit requirements.
What is SCD Modelling in Loyalty Data
Slowly Changing Dimensions are a data warehousing pattern used to track how dimension records—such as member profiles, reward categories, or campaign configurations—evolve over time. Rather than treating each update as a destructive replacement, SCD modelling captures the before and after state of a record, timestamped and linked to the originating event. Xoxoday Loyalife applies SCD Type 2 logic by default for core compliance-sensitive dimensions. This means that when a member’s loyalty tier is upgraded from Silver to Gold, both records coexist in the data model with effective-from and effective-to date ranges. Queries can reconstruct the exact state of any member account at any historical point in time.Why This Matters for Enterprise Compliance
Organisations operating under ISO 27001, SOC 2 Type II, or regional data privacy regulations require demonstrable control over how personally identifiable information and transactional records are maintained. SCD modelling provides the structural foundation that makes those controls provable. For teams integrating Xoxoday Loyalife with HR systems such as Workday, SAP SuccessFactors, or Darwinbox, historical dimension tracking ensures that employee records synced into the loyalty platform retain a correct audit trail even when the source system changes an employee’s cost centre, role, or employment status. A points allocation made to an employee in Q1 remains traceable to the correct organisational entity, even if that entity is restructured by Q3.Practical Example: Member Tier Change Audit
Consider a scenario where a compliance officer needs to verify that a specific member received the correct reward multiplier during a promotional period. Because Xoxoday Loyalife stores the tier dimension with SCD versioning, the audit query returns the exact tier record active on the date in question—not the current tier. This eliminates ambiguity and satisfies evidence requests from internal audit teams or external regulators without requiring manual reconstruction from logs.Integration with Reporting and Analytics
SCD-modelled data flows cleanly into downstream reporting pipelines and BI tools. When Xoxoday Loyalife data is exported to a data warehouse or surfaced through dashboards, dimension tables carry the full version history. Analytics teams can segment loyalty KPIs by historical cohorts, measure tier migration rates over time, and produce point-in-time snapshots that align with financial reporting periods. This architecture also supports notification workflows. Teams using Slack or MS Teams integrations with Xoxoday Loyalife can receive automated alerts when a compliance-critical dimension record is versioned, keeping the right stakeholders informed without manual monitoring. Learn more: Xoxoday Loyalife Help Centre — GeneralData security and audit logging in Loyalife
How Xoxoday Loyalife captures and retains audit logs for all administrative and transactional events.
HR system integrations: Workday, SAP, and Darwinbox
How Xoxoday Loyalife syncs employee dimension data from leading HRIS platforms while preserving record integrity.